Virtual Brain
Although Virtual Brain incorporates the complex world of neurochemistry only to a small degree it gains a lot by not becoming as complex as the brain itself.
Virtual Brain instead embraces and extends new concepts from computational, cognitive and clinical neurology to drastically reduce the complexity of the model providing the same output as brain clinical scanners.
